本発明は、人形の股関節構造及び該股関節構造を備えた人形に関するものである。   The present invention relates to a doll hip joint structure and a doll provided with the hip joint structure.

周知の通り、関節を可動できる人形においては、関節を可動させた際に思い通りの姿勢をとらせることができ、かつ、それぞれの姿勢において美しい外観を保つことが必要となる。しかし、硬質な素材によって形成された人形においては、外観を優先して関節を形成すると、隣接する部材が干渉し合って思い通りの姿勢をとらせることができず、また、可動を優先して関節を形成すると、隣接する部材の間に大きな隙間が生じて外観が損なわれるため、これら二つの要件を満たす関節の開発は非常に困難とされている。   As is well known, a doll that can move a joint can take a desired posture when the joint is moved, and it is necessary to maintain a beautiful appearance in each posture. However, in dolls made of hard materials, if joints are formed with priority on the appearance, adjacent members can interfere with each other and cannot take the desired posture. Forming a large gap between adjacent members and deteriorating the appearance, making it difficult to develop a joint that satisfies these two requirements.

例えば、後出特許文献1には、胴部の下端に腰部が分割連接し、これに左右脚部が連接し、この左右脚部は左右大腿および左右足付の左右下腿とからなり、左右足には連結可能の足フックを設けている。そして、胴部の下部内方空胴に設けた案内棒に足引張りコイルばねの中央を引掛け、それから両側を胴部の下端より腰部を上下に貫通し、左右脚部内を基端より先端へと挿通し、左右下腿内の掛棒に両先端を引掛け、足引張りコイルばねを内設し、胴部に対して腰部および左右脚部の各連続面を圧接し、腰部および左右脚部を所要に弾支している人形玩具が開示されている。   For example, in Patent Document 1 below, the waist is divided and connected to the lower end of the torso, and the left and right legs are connected to the lower leg. The left and right legs are composed of left and right thighs and left and right lower legs with left and right legs. Is provided with a connectable foot hook. Then, hook the center of the leg tension coil spring to the guide rod provided in the lower inner cavity of the torso, then pierce the waist from the lower end of the torso up and down on both sides, and inside the left and right legs from the base to the tip , Hook both ends to the hanging rod in the left and right lower legs, install a leg tension coil spring, press the continuous surface of the waist and left and right legs against the torso, and attach the waist and left and right legs A doll toy that is supported as required is disclosed.

また、後出特許文献2には、人形の手足を胴の内部に配した紐状の弾性体で連結する連結構造において、左右の大腿部に連結する一対の弾性体を人形の首部から下方に吊り下げた吊具に連結し、吊具から大腿部を連結する弾性体は、可動自在な腰部を通して大腿部に連結されている人形玩具が開示されている。   Further, in Patent Document 2 below, in a connection structure in which the doll's limbs are connected by a string-like elastic body arranged inside the torso, a pair of elastic bodies connected to the left and right thighs are provided below the doll's neck. A doll toy connected to a thigh through a movable waist is disclosed as an elastic body that is connected to a hanger suspended from the hanger and connects the thigh from the hanger.

さらに、後出特許文献3には、人形自体の主体となる空洞状の胴体部と、この胴体部の上部に屈曲自在に弾発的に連繋した頸部分を有する頭体部と、同じく胴体部の上部左右の肩部分に屈曲自在に弾発的に連繋した左右の腕体部と、同じく胴体部の下部底面に屈曲自在に弾発的に連繋した左右脚体部と、頭体部、腕体部、脚体部夫々を胴体部内部で弾発的に牽引連繋する保持手段とからなり、脚体部は、胴体部の下部底面左右に形成したほぼ球面状の脚体連結凹面に嵌め入れられる筒状の腿部分、球筒状の膝部分、足首・足指を一体化してある脛部分を連繋して成り、保持手段は、頭体部内部、脚体部の脛部分内部夫々で頭体・脚体末端部を係止すると共に、胴体部の上下で貫通することで頭体部、左右の脚体部夫々の相互を連繋している頭体・脚体弾性紐材とから形成してある人形が開示されている。
実開昭63−166295号 実用新案登録第3058140号 実用新案登録第3068703号
Further, in Patent Document 3 described later, a hollow body portion that is a main body of the doll itself, a head body portion that has a neck portion that is elastically connected to the upper portion of the body portion, and a body portion that is also the same. Left and right arm body parts flexibly and flexibly connected to the upper left and right shoulder parts, and left and right leg body parts flexibly and flexibly linked to the lower bottom surface of the body part, and the head body and arms The body part and the leg part are composed of holding means for elastically pulling and linking the body part and the body part, and the leg part is fitted into a substantially spherical leg connecting concave surface formed on the left and right sides of the lower part of the body part. The cylindrical thigh part, the spherical cylindrical knee part, and the shin part where the ankles and toes are integrated are connected to each other, and the holding means are inside the head part and inside the shin part of the leg part. The head that locks the body / leg end and connects the head part and the left and right leg parts to each other by penetrating up and down the torso part. · Leg doll elastic is formed from the cord material is disclosed.
Japanese Utility Model Sho 63-166295 Utility model registration No. 3058140 Utility model registration No. 30687703

特許文献1や特許文献2に開示された人形のように、胴部材の股間部を鼠径部に沿うように略V字状に形成して脚部材を連結した場合には、胴部材と脚部材との間に隙間が生じ難く、外観を美しく構成することができるが、股関節を屈曲させた際に、胴部材の股関節に当たる部分と脚部材の股関節に当たる部分とが干渉し合って自然と股が開いた状態となるという問題点があった。   As in the dolls disclosed in Patent Document 1 and Patent Document 2, when the leg members are connected by forming the crotch portion of the trunk member in a substantially V shape along the groin, the trunk member and the leg member It is difficult to create a gap between the hip joint and the hip joint. There was a problem of being in an open state.

これに対して、特許文献3に開示された人形のように、胴部材の股間部を比較的水平に形成して脚部材を連結した場合には、前記各特許文献に開示された人形のように股関節を屈曲させた際における股の開きはなくなるものの、胴部材と脚部材との間に大きな隙間が生じると共に、両部材の繋ぎ目が不自然な形状になるため、外観が損なわれるという問題点があり、さらに、胴部材と脚部材との接触面が小さくなるため、立ち姿勢における股関節の安定性が損なわれるという問題点もあった。   On the other hand, as in the doll disclosed in Patent Document 3, when the crotch portion of the trunk member is formed relatively horizontally and the leg members are connected, the doll disclosed in each Patent Document When the hip joint is bent, the opening of the crotch is lost, but there is a large gap between the body member and the leg member, and the joint between the two members becomes an unnatural shape, and the appearance is impaired. In addition, since the contact surface between the trunk member and the leg member is small, there is a problem that the stability of the hip joint in the standing posture is impaired.

そこで、本発明は、胴部材の股間部を鼠径部に沿った略V字状に形成して脚部材を連結させる構造であるにもかかわらず、股関節を屈曲させても股が開かない人形の股関節構造を得ることを技術的課題として、その具現化をはかるべく、試作・実験を繰り返した結果、脚部材を胴部材に対して回転可能に連結してなる人形の股関節構造において、胴部材に股間部が鼠径部に沿った形状となるように該股間部を挟んで両側に股関節凹部を形成し、脚部材に股関節凹部に嵌る形状の股関節凸部を形成し、両股関節凹部を胴部材に対する脚部材の回転軸からずれて伸びるように形成された連結孔によって繋ぎ、両脚部材の股関節凸部を股関節凹部に嵌めた状態において連結孔を通して架け渡される連結弾性体によって互いに牽引し、胴部材に対して脚部材を屈曲させることによって連結弾性体を連結孔に沿って回転軸の前側上方に誘導させるように構成すれば、胴部材を脚部材に対して屈曲させた際における股の開きを規制することができるという刮目すべき知見を得、前記技術的課題を達成したものである。   Therefore, the present invention is a doll whose crotch portion of the trunk member is formed in a substantially V shape along the groin portion and the leg member is connected, but the crotch is not opened even if the hip joint is bent. Obtaining a hip joint structure as a technical issue, and as a result of repeated trials and experiments to achieve its realization, the doll's hip joint structure in which the leg member is rotatably connected to the trunk member, Hip joint recesses are formed on both sides of the crotch part so that the crotch part is shaped along the groin, and hip joint protrusions are formed on the leg members so as to fit into the hip joint recesses. It is connected by a connecting hole formed so as to extend away from the rotation axis of the leg member, and is pulled to each other by a connecting elastic body spanned through the connecting hole in a state where the hip joint convex portions of both leg members are fitted into the hip joint concave portions, for If the connecting elastic body is guided to the upper front side of the rotating shaft along the connecting hole by bending the member, the opening of the crotch when the body member is bent with respect to the leg member can be restricted. We have obtained a remarkable knowledge that we can do it, and have achieved the technical problem.

本発明によれば、両脚部材を股間部に形成された連結孔に通される連結弾性体によって互いに牽引させ、胴部材に対して脚部材を屈曲させた際に、連結弾性体が連結孔に誘導されて回転軸に対して前側上方に位置付けられるように構成したので、胴部材に対して脚部材を屈曲させた際に、股関節凹部と股関節凸部との干渉によって生じる脚部材を開かせる動きと脚部材を外側へ回転させる動きが回転軸に対して前側上方に位置付けられる連結弾性体の牽引によって抑制され、胴部材に対して脚部材を屈曲させた際に股を閉じた状態の姿勢を保つことができる。   According to the present invention, when the leg members are pulled together by the connecting elastic body that is passed through the connecting hole formed in the crotch portion and the leg member is bent with respect to the trunk member, the connecting elastic body becomes the connecting hole. Since it is configured to be guided and positioned on the upper front side with respect to the rotation shaft, when the leg member is bent with respect to the trunk member, the movement of opening the leg member caused by the interference between the hip joint concave portion and the hip joint convex portion And the movement of rotating the leg member outward is restrained by the pulling of the connecting elastic body positioned on the front upper side with respect to the rotation axis, and the crotch is closed when the leg member is bent with respect to the trunk member. Can keep.

また、股間部が鼠径部に沿った形状になっていることから、連結孔の両股関節凹部間の幅も下端から上端へ向かうに従って広くなり、股関節を屈曲させることによって連通孔の下端部から上端部へ誘導された連結弾性体はより引き伸ばされた状態となって両脚部材を牽引する力が増すように構成したので、連結弾性体による両脚部材への牽引力を必要としない胴部材に対して脚部材を屈曲させていない状態において連結弾性体の牽引力が小さくなり、連結弾性体による両脚部材への牽引力を必要とする胴部材に対して脚部材を屈曲させた状態において連結弾性体の牽引力が大きくなり、各姿勢における連結弾性体の牽引力が適正な大きさに調整される。   In addition, since the crotch portion has a shape along the groin portion, the width between the two hip joint recesses of the connecting hole also increases from the lower end to the upper end, and the hip joint is bent to be bent from the lower end to the upper end of the communication hole. Since the connecting elastic body guided to the part is in a more stretched state and the force for pulling the both leg members is increased, the connecting elastic body does not require the pulling force to the both leg members by the connecting elastic body. When the member is not bent, the traction force of the connecting elastic body is small, and the traction force of the connecting elastic body is large when the leg member is bent with respect to the body member that requires the pulling force to the both leg members by the connecting elastic body. Thus, the traction force of the connecting elastic body in each posture is adjusted to an appropriate magnitude.

次に、本実施の形態に係る人形の股関節の動作について説明する。   Next, the operation of the hip joint of the doll according to the present embodiment will be described.

股関節を屈曲させる前においては、図6の(a)に示すように、連結弾性体33は股間部9の連結孔26における下端部を通過して両脚部材5の間に架け渡された状態となっている。ところが、股関節を屈曲させると、図6の(b)に示すように、連結弾性体33は股間部9の連結孔26に沿って誘導されて連結孔26における上端部を通過して両脚部材5の間に架け渡された状態となる。この時、股間部9が鼠径部に沿った形状になっているため、股関節凹部24と股関節凸部27とが干渉し合って脚部材5を開かせる力(図5の(b)中、矢印A)が働くと共に脚部材5を回転させる力(図5の(b)中、矢印B)が働く。しかし、連結弾性体33が回転軸34に対して前側に位置付けられるため、回転軸34を支点として脚部材5を閉じるような力が働くと共に、連結弾性体33が回転軸34に対して上方に位置付けられるため、回転軸34を支点として脚部材5を内側へ回転させるような力が働き、これら二つの力が股関節凹部24と股関節凸部27との干渉によって生じる力を規制する。   Before bending the hip joint, as shown in FIG. 6A, the connecting elastic body 33 passes through the lower end portion of the connecting hole 26 of the crotch portion 9 and is bridged between both leg members 5. It has become. However, when the hip joint is bent, as shown in FIG. 6B, the connecting elastic body 33 is guided along the connecting hole 26 of the crotch portion 9 and passes through the upper end portion of the connecting hole 26, and the both leg members 5. It will be in a state of being bridged between. At this time, since the crotch portion 9 has a shape along the inguinal portion, the hip joint concave portion 24 and the hip joint convex portion 27 interfere with each other to open the leg member 5 (in FIG. 5B, an arrow A) works and a force for rotating the leg member 5 (arrow B in FIG. 5B) works. However, since the connecting elastic body 33 is positioned on the front side with respect to the rotating shaft 34, a force that closes the leg member 5 acts with the rotating shaft 34 as a fulcrum, and the connecting elastic body 33 moves upward with respect to the rotating shaft 34. Therefore, a force that rotates the leg member 5 inward with the rotating shaft 34 as a fulcrum acts, and these two forces restrict the force generated by the interference between the hip joint recess 24 and the hip joint protrusion 27.

また、股間部9が鼠径部に沿った形状になっていることから、連結孔26の両股関節凹部24間の幅も下端から上端へ向かうに従って広くなり、股関節を屈曲させることによって連通孔26の下端部から上端部へ誘導された連結弾性体33はより引き伸ばされた状態となって両脚部材5を牽引する力が増す。   Further, since the crotch portion 9 has a shape along the groin portion, the width between the two hip joint recesses 24 of the connecting hole 26 increases from the lower end to the upper end, and the hip hole is bent to allow the communication hole 26 to be bent. The connecting elastic body 33 guided from the lower end portion to the upper end portion is in a more extended state, and the force for pulling both the leg members 5 is increased.

よって、胴部材3に対して脚部材5を屈曲させた際に脚部材5に働く前記二つの力が連結弾性体33の牽引力により規制され、座った状態の姿勢を美しく維持できる。   Therefore, the two forces acting on the leg member 5 when the leg member 5 is bent with respect to the body member 3 are regulated by the traction force of the connecting elastic body 33, and the sitting posture can be beautifully maintained.
